Putting Companion Care Into Context

To me, it’s more than the list of services.

My wife Shirley and I got married 16 years ago.

I’ll tell you the truth, we met through a matchmaking service. I remember the first time we met. I believe it was the 28th of June, 2003. I had to push it back about a week because I had a bloody nose that wouldn’t quit, believe it or not. We went to Runza. I had coffee and she had tea and we talked.

We started traveling and went on several cruises together. We went on an Alaskan cruise where I won a raffle for a Caribbean cruise. We celebrated our third anniversary there.

Tracy came into our lives a few years ago. Shirley started needing help and Tracy was her primary caregiver. Tracy also cared for me. She was one of the first people I contacted when Shirley passed away at our home in May of 2020.

Since then, Tracy has become my caregiver. When she made the switch to HCAN, I followed her.

Together, we’ve been through many of life’s ups and downs. I know about her children and grandchildren, and she knows about my family. We make each other laugh and we love each other like family. She’s even helped my diabetes. She preps my meals every day, helping me lose 50 pounds and counting.

I’ve downsized recently. I didn’t need that big house anymore that Shirley and I shared. Tracy helped me pick out places to tour and went to those with me. It’s nice to know she’s there to help me.

I’m glad Tracy and I haven’t shaken each other yet. Staying home versus going to a nursing home has made everything easier for me. I’m glad Shirley and I met Tracy – my friend and caregiver.
